Typical Problems with Windows and Doors
Windows and doors can experience a series of concerns in time. Knowing these typical problems can assist homeowners take timely action, boosting both the durability and performance of their components.
Normal Issues EncounteredDrafts: Poor insulation can permit cold air in and warm air out, resulting in increased energy bills.Problem in Operation: Windows and doors may become stuck or challenging to open due to swelling from humidity or other factors.Broken Seals: Double-glazed windows can establish broken seals that jeopardize insulation.Squeaky Hinges: Doors typically struggle with squeaks due to worn-out hinges or lack of lubrication.Cracked Glass: External elements such as hail or flying particles can lead to split or broken glass panes.Decaying Frames: Wooden frames can rot due to extended exposure to wetness.Misalignment: Doors might become misaligned, causing spaces that allow bugs or wetness to get in.Condensation: Moisture between glass panes shows an unsuccessful seal, affecting insulation and clearness.Issue TypeSignsPossible CausesDraftsFeel cold air around windows/doorsPoor insulation or used weather condition strippingProblem in OperationSticking or hard to openSwelling from humidity or dirt buildupBroken SealsCondensation in between glass panesFailures in adhesive or sealantSqueaky HingesSound when opening/closing doorsDamaged hinges or lack of lubricationCracked GlassNoticeable fractures or shatteringHail or effect damageRotting FramesFlaking paint, soft woodLong direct exposure to moistureMisalignmentGaps or uneven closingSettling of your houseCondensationWetness caught between panesFailed sealsValue of Timely Repairs

Understanding the costs associated with doors and window repairs can assist homeowners budget plan efficiently. The following table describes common repair expenses:
Repair TypeEstimated Cost RangeWeatherstripping₤ 5 - ₤ 20 per windowLubrication of Hinges₤ 10 - ₤ 30Glass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 500 per paneFrame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 1000 per windowExpert Repair Service₤ 75 - ₤ 150 per hour
Note: Costs can vary based on place, the intricacy of the repair, and the materials used.
Preventative Maintenance Tips
To increase the life expectancy of doors and windows, routine maintenance is crucial. Here are some proactive actions property owners can take:
Inspect Regularly: Look for indications of wear, damage, or drafts at least twice a year.Tidy Glass and Frames: Keeping doors and windows clean prevents accumulation of dirt that can cause deterioration.Conduct Routine Lubrication: Regularly lube hinges to ensure smooth operation.Examine Seals: Inspect and change weather condition removing and seals as needed.Examine for Rot: Look for indicators of rot, particularly in wooden frames, and address problems early.Frequently asked questionsWhat are signs that I need to change my windows?Substantial drafts or air leaksNoticeable condensation in between glass panesBreaking or decomposing framesDifficulty opening or closing windowsCan I repair windows myself?
Small repairs, such as replacing weather removing, lubricating hinges, and altering broken glass panes, can often be done by property owners. Nevertheless, for major structural issues, expert help is recommended.
How often should I carry out maintenance on my windows and doors?
At minimum, inspect your windows and doors two times a year, ideally in the spring and fall. Routine maintenance can avoid more significant problems.
